There are rare cases of infringement in the images - [The National Biodiversity Strategy and the Executive Plan for the Republic of Yemen ](https://2socotra.com/the-national-biodiversity-strategy-and-the-executive-plan-for-the-republic-of-yemen/): Biological Diversity Convention: The Convention on Biological Diversity deals with the genetic differences of all types of plants, animals, and microorganisms, as well as the ecosystems in which they live. During the Earth Summit in Rio de Janeiro in 1992, the door was opened for signature. Within a year of its date, the number of signatories to the agreement reached one hundred and sixty-eight, making it the most widespread Convention globally. Under this agreement. the signatories pledge to achieve the three objectives of the agreement  1- Conservation of biodiversity 2- Sustainable use of biodiversity 3- Equitable partnership for the benefits of the exploitation of environmental resources The signatory parties to the Convention also undertake to prepare a strategy and a national action plan for biodiversity that translate the objectives of the Convention into operational procedures by the provisions of its articles (6) and (26) as well as implementing all the requirements of the agreement National efforts to conserve biodiversity and sustainable development: Yemen signed an agreement Biodiversity in 1992, during the holding of the Earth Summit in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il, and in 1995 it was ratified by the Yemeni government. The signing of the agreement comes as an appreciation by the Yemeni government of the importance of biodiversity resources and as an integral part of the efforts to manage the country’s natural heritage. This legacy represents long-term benefits for the Yemeni people and is a basic necessity for sustainable national development. The signing of the agreement is also a declaration of steadfastness and a pledge from the Yemeni government to follow the sustainable use and conservation of natural resources and exercise its responsibilities within the framework of that approach. The signing of the agreement is also an expression of the government’s awareness and awareness that the lives of current and future generations depend on the abundance and protection of biological resources. The government’s interest in environmental issues and their safety is relatively recent, as this interest emerged with the establishment of the Environmental Protection Council in 1990 AD and its restructuring under the name of the General Authority for Environmental Protection under the misguidance of the Ministry of Water and Environment in 2001 AD. New Drone Permit Fee: $100 for Aerial Footage Starting in 2024, travelers bringing drones to Socotra must pay a $100 permit fee, which is collected by the tour agency upon arrival along with visa fees. To facilitate the permit process, travelers should provide the drone model and the operator’s name in advance. This regulation helps ensure responsible drone usage, balancing security concerns with the need to protect Socotra’s fragile ecosystem.. How to Legally Fly a Drone on Socotra Island The $100 payment grants you the ability to fly your drone legally across the island, though it’s always wise to double-check for any restricted areas where flying may be prohibited, such as near military or sensitive zones. Following these regulations not only helps you avoid penalties but also supports the island’s conservation efforts by minimizing disturbances to wildlife. Bring Your Own Drone: No Rental Options on the Island Another essential tip for travelers is that there are no drone rental services on Socotra. If you’re a photographer or videographer planning to capture the island’s landscapes from the sky, make sure to pack your own drone and all the necessary accessories. There’s simply no local infrastructure on Socotra to provide rental drones, repairs, or even spare parts for drones that may malfunction. Essential Drone Gear for Socotra: Batteries, Memory Cards, and Chargers Given the remoteness of the island and limited connectivity, it’s also a good idea to pack additional batteries, memory cards, and portable chargers. Without easy access to drone shops, preparation is key to making sure your drone can perform optimally during your stay. Whether you’re an adventurer or a filmmaker, we’ll ensure your journey to Socotra is unforgettable! - [Wonderful | The Fantastic Firmhin Forest Made Socotra Island Heaven](https://2socotra.com/wonderful-the-fantastic-firmhin-forest-made-socotra-island-heaven-2/): Firmhin Forest, located in the heart of Socotra Island, is a unique natural wonder that captivates visitors with its ancient landscapes and rich biodiversity. Known as the “Dragon’s Blood Tree Sanctuary,” this forest is home to the world-famous Dragon’s Blood Tree (Dracaena cinnabari), a species found only on Socotra. The forest’s surreal beauty and ecological significance make it a must-visit destination for anyone exploring this remote island in the Arabian Sea. A Natural Marvel in the Arabian Sea  Socotra Island, often referred to as the “Galápagos of the Indian Ocean,” is renowned for its remarkable biodiversity, with nearly 700 species of plants and animals found nowhere else on Earth. Firmhin Forest, situated on a rocky plateau in the island’s interior, is one of Socotra’s most striking landscapes. The forest is characterized by the presence of Dragon’s Blood Trees, whose unusual umbrella-shaped crowns and twisted trunks dominate the rugged terrain. These trees have adapted to the island’s harsh, arid environment, thriving where few other species can survive. Their ability to capture and funnel moisture to their roots through their wide canopies allows them to flourish in this dry landscape. The Mystique of the Dragon’s Blood Tree The Dragon’s Blood Tree is the most iconic species in Firmhin Forest, named for the crimson resin it produces, known as “dragon’s blood.” This resin has been valued for centuries for its medicinal properties and uses in traditional medicine, dyes, and varnishes. The tree’s appearance is equally intriguing, with thick, gnarled trunks and dense, spiky crowns that create a canopy resembling a giant mushroom. The forest’s prehistoric atmosphere, created by these ancient trees, provides a glimpse into a world that has remained largely unchanged for millennia. The Dragon’s Blood Tree is not just a botanical curiosity; it is a symbol of Socotra’s unique natural heritage and the island’s resilience in the face of environmental challenges. A Sanctuary for Unique Wildlife Firmhin Forest is not only a botanical treasure trove but also a critical habitat for Socotra’s endemic wildlife. The forest is home to a variety of bird species, including the Socotra Sunbird, the Socotra Warbler, and the Socotra Sparrow, all of which are found nowhere else in the world. In addition to its avian inhabitants, the forest supports several species of reptiles, such as the Socotra Skink and the Socotra Chameleon. The forest floor, covered in a mosaic of lichens, mosses, and low-growing plants, provides a rich environment for these creatures. This unique ecosystem is a key reason why Socotra is rec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age Site, highlighting the island’s global importance in terms of biodiversity conservation. The Many Names of the Dragon’s Blood Tree: Myth and Science  The Dragon’s Blood Tree, scientifically known as Dracaena cinnabari, is most commonly referred to by this name due to the striking crimson resin it produces. Locally in Yemen, it is also called the “Blood Tree of the Two Brothers,” a name rooted in the legend of Cain and Abel, symbolizing the tree’s mythical origin. Additionally, it is sometimes known as the “Socotra Dragon Tree,” emphasizing its unique presence on Socotra Island. These names reflect both the tree’s distinct physical characteristics and its rich cultural significance. What Is the Local Name for the Dragon’s Blood Tree? On Socotra Island, the Dragon’s Blood Tree is locally known as “Arhib” and sometimes called “the blood of the Phoenix.” However, intense storms and rampant goat grazing are threatening these iconic trees, which are crucial for water supply and the fragile ecosystem. Socotra, with its 50,000 residents, has largely escaped the ravages of Yemen’s ongoing conflict since 2014 but still faces environmental challenges. Recognized by UNESCO since 2008, the archipelago is home to around 825 plant species, with over a third being unique to the region. The Dragon’s Blood Tree, notable for its medicinal properties, exemplifies this rich biodiversity. Biological Insights into the Dragon’s Blood Tree The Dragon’s Blood Tree has a unique, umbrella-like shape that helps it survive in arid, mountainous conditions with minimal soil. Its dense crown provides shade, reducing evaporation and protecting seedlings below. This evergreen tree, known for its dark red resin called “dragon’s blood,” displays secondary growth similar to that of dicot trees, despite being a monocot. Being on Socotra Island opens the door for a unique journey; therefore, knowing what you can prepare in advance to enjoy your time perfectly. Get Ready! 10 Easy Points You Need to Know Before Travel to Socotra Island One – What Documents Do you Need when Traveling to Socotra Island? 1- Passport: Getting a passport is a must for being on Socotra Island. However, it needs to be taken into account that Israeli passports are prohibited. Any evidence in the passport that proves that you visited Israel makes your passport unacceptable to enter Socotra Island. Therefore, you have to obtain a new passport. 2- Travel Visa: Getting a visa to enter Socotra Island, which costs $150, is considered the first and the essential phase tourists should consider. You have two ways to get a visa. Booking a tour is the first and preferable way that tourists always choose. The second way uncommon is to contact with tourist agency in Socotra Island to prepare only the visa for you without the tour. The visa will be emailed to you for booking the flight, valid for 30 days to stay in Yemen. After arrival, they will stamp the lower slip of the paper and give it to you. 3- Travel and Health Insurance: Before heading to Socotra, Yemen, you must apply for travel and health insurance. The travel insurance will protect the cost of your trip when you might face a flight delay or cancellation situation. Two – What to Bring Camping for Socotra Island? There are a lot of attractive places which let tourists camp there. Therefore, your tour operator will prepare all the essential camping equipment. Camping in nature is one of the best activities you can enjoy. There are six eco-campsites to stay overnight outside Hadibo, Socotra island’s capital city, Omek, Di Hamri, Detwah, Homhil, and Rush. They are run by local communities who generate income by providing eco-tourism services for their development. When camping outside with 2Socotra tour operator, maximum comfort will be prepared for you, including freshly cooked lunch/ dinner, drinking water, tea/ coffee, dessert, a relaxing area with mattresses on a large mat, and tents, gas or solar lamps. All stuff, including your baggage, will be brought by a 4WD car to the place of Camping.  Accommodation in an eco-campsite provides only essential comfort. Still, you are in the middle of nature and can fully indulge in the island’s beauties. Therefore, it is more convenient to stay overnight in eco-campsites located around the island than to drive every night back to Hadibo.  Three – What to Wear on Socotra Island Vacation? There are such kinds of clothes that tourists should prepare to match the weather and the climate changes on Socotra Island. Getting light, breathable fabrics to explore Socotra Island is a good idea. A light jacket is recommended because it is excellent in the evenings ( 16 – 22 ). Different beliefs about wearing clothes that tourists should be in consideration. As a woman, being conservative, especially in villages, is a must, but it is not expected for women outside of the main towns. A light headscarf covers the hair. And they are making sure that shoulders and knees are covered, too. On the other side, as a man, legs should be covered while t-shirts are fine in villages. Hats or other head coverings are good alternatives to protect yourself from the sun. Sturdy shoes are a great idea, keeping in mind the coats are sandy, and there are also lots of fun dunes to climb.  Socotri men typically wear a t-shirt paired with a fouta ( a long wrap-around skirt similar to Bangladeshi men), while women are almost entirely covered in niqab and abaya. If you want to wear such kinds of Socotri Clothes, you can purchase these items in Hadibo City, the capital city of Socotra Island. It does not cost only $ 10- $20 for each item.  Four – Cash is Matter When Traveling to Socotra Island There are no ATMs on the island, and credit cards are unavailable. Tourists should bring clean and unworn banknotes USD cash to the island, and you change it on the black market once in Hadibo City or Mainland Yemen. The official exchange rate is no longer helpful and not accurate. Yemen has two black market prices for the exchange rate in the south and the north of the country, so you have to check with your operator the daily rate for the south. If you have any concerns about your safety due to moving with cash, don’t worry; the island is very safe, and there is no indecent reported by any tourist. Five – Everything You Need to Know About the Electricity in Socotra islandElectricity is available in Hadibo. Moreover, it exists in the larger towns as well. But since most of the visit will be in campsites you will not have electricity for the vast majority of the time, so be ready to bring what we recommend. Therefore, as a solution, have your power bank. We highly recommend carrying a solar charger and external battery packs (for charging camera batteries or laptops). You have to check this power bank out for charging phones and tablets. A powerful USB power bank is convenient for charging electronics and bringing several additional camera batteries for photographers that let your journey pass smoothly.  Some camps have a generator we can run in the evenings, which facilitates your needs, but they may or may not have sockets (Euro 2-prong, and British 3-prong) to charge electronics. The Characteristics of the Dragon’s Blood Trees  The dragon’s blood tree is a rare type of plant and belongs to the genus “Dracaena” of the family “Asparagaceae.” The tree grows on rocky ground and in high places; It can retain water for long years, tolerate drought, and adapt to arid conditions with little water and soil. The history of the Dragon’s Blood Tree goes back more than 50 million years; It appeared in the Mediterranean basin and is found in a nature reserve that includes more than 360 species of rare plants and animals on the island of Socotra in Yemen. It is also found on Mount Dhofar in the Sultanate of Oman and in some semi-tropical forests. What Does the Dragon’s Blood Tree Look Like? Like other monocotyledons, such as palms, the dragon’s blood tree grows from the tip of the stem, with the long, stiff leaves borne in dense rosettes at the end (4, 5, 7). It branches at maturity to produce an umbrella-shaped crown, with leaves that measure up to 60 cm long and 3 cm wide. The trunk and the branches of the dragon blood are thick and stout and display dichotomous branching, where each of the units repeatedly divides into two sections. The Benefits of the Dragon’s Blood Trees The most important thing that distinguishes the dragon’s blood tree from all trees in the world is the appearance of blood when its stem is cut off; That is why that name is called it. This bloody liquid is a kind of “resin” crimson in color; it has no smell or taste. It is of very great importance. It contains an active substance called “Draco” that has many medical uses and is used in the pharmaceutical industry to treat some health problems, including: Treatment of wounds and burns; It works to clot the blood and heal wounds quickly. Treating infections and skin ulcers. Treating digestive problems and stomach ulcers. Stop internal bleeding anywhere inside the human body. Antiseptic and astringent for gums. It involves in manufacturing kinds of toothpaste. Draco includes in some industries: wool dyeing, varnish and printing ink industry, marble dyeing, pottery coloring, lipstick industry, and many other industries and uses. In short, they are treating infections and skin ulcers and treating digestive problems, and stomach ulcers. Stop internal bleeding anywhere inside the human body. Antiseptic and astringent for gums. It involves in the manufacture of kinds of toothpaste. How Are Seeds of the Dragon’s Blood Trees Different? Its fruits are small fleshy berries containing between 1 and 4 seeds. They turn from green to black and then become orange when ripe as they develop. The birds eat berries (e.g., Onychognatus species) and dispersed. The seeds are 4–5 mm in diameter and weigh on average 68 mg. The berries exude a deep red resin known as dragon’s blood. The Red Honey in Dragon’s Blood Trees Red honey is extracted from the dragon’s blood tree. It is one of the most expensive types of honey, and it has many health benefits. The roots are used in some treatments, including the treatment of rheumatism. The tree’s wood is also used in some industries, including the manufacture of beehives, and the leaves are used in the manufacture of ropes. And do not forget its importance as a giant canopy under which rare animals live, protecting them from the sun’s harmful rays. Do Dragon’s Blood Trees have another name?  The tree is also called the “Blood Tree of the Two Brothers,” and this name goes back to the story of Cain and Abel, Where the first murder on Earth occurred. It is said in a Yemeni legend that Cain and Abel were the first to live on the island of Socotra, and when Cain killed his brother Abel, blood flowed, and the blood tree of the two brothers (the dragon’s blood tree) grew. Caves More than 52 caves are on Socotra Island. The historical events that Socotra Island passed by affected its environment. How? Each hole in the mountain tells a story about the cave. Because of erosion that the Island got through like gradual wearing away of the Earth by wind or water; disintegration. Some caves exist because of the solution of calcine. The unique part is that some of these caves are settled by people who live their daily routines. Some of these caves contain peculiar drawings which attract tourists to see. An example of that is Hoq Cave. It used as a religious temple for those who traveled from Aisa to Africa and vise versa. Beaches Around the edge of Socotra Island, many beaches spread along the way of the Island. Their length is around 482.8km. There are different distinctive features that beaches have. For example, there are dunes of sand, and they are white, which attracts tourists the most. Several palm trees have spread away from the beaches. The clear waters of the beaches are perfect for relaxing. Diving is one of the main activities that locals and foreigners love to do. Different touristic services are available around the beaches. There are so many species considered too unique and rare to be found anywhere, such as loggerheads. Coral reefs are also as pearls. An example of these beaches is Shoab Beach. Mountains There are several mountains found on Socotra Island. They have different hight and different spaces. Some of these mountains are huge, like Hajmar Mountain. The location of these mountain is in the east of the Island, around 25km from Hadibo bay. They are wider from the east part than the west part. There are many tops of these mountains, like Daqam Top, considered the highest top there. It is around 1630m high.Furthermore, there are different shapes of the mountains on Socotra Island.
